Annika Nelde is a scholar working on Immunology, Molecular Biology and Oncology. According to data from OpenAlex, Annika Nelde has authored 51 papers receiving a total of 629 ind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Immunology, 27 papers in Molecular Biology and 21 papers in Oncology. Recurrent topics in Annika Nelde's work include vaccines and immunoinformatics approaches (24 papers), Immunotherapy and Immune Responses (24 papers) and CAR-T cell therapy research (11 papers). Annika Nelde is often cited by papers focused on vaccines and immunoinformatics approaches (24 papers), Immunotherapy and Immune Responses (24 papers) and CAR-T cell therapy research (11 papers). Annika Nelde collaborates with scholars based in Germany, United States and Switzerland. Annika Nelde's co-authors include Juliane S. Walz, Hans‐Georg Rammensee, Stefan Stevanović, Helmut R. Salih, Daniel J. Kowalewski, Malte Roerden, Jonas S. Heitmann, Yacine Maringer, Jens Bauer and Heiko Schuster and has published in prestigious journals such as The Journal of Experimental Medicine, Journal of Clinical Oncology and Blood.
